Title: JDR 113 Picked On SundayBrazilian Embroidery Pattern. A fresh picked floral bouquet of garden flowers wonderful for your Sunday table!
JDR 113 Picked On Sunday Brazilian Embroidery DesignA Floral Embroidery Pattern Original Design by Rose Marie Diem.The directions has referrals to the EdMar book and the Barbara Demke Johnson Book. A Flower Placement Chart now has been added. Stitching Area: 7" x 9.25" Intended Finished Size: 12" x12" Apx. Fabric Cut Size: 15 x 15" The following EdMar threads were used in the stitched sample:
